Application and Adaptation

When you decide to drop a few extra pounds or start a new exercise routine you need a progressive point of reference. Indeed you should include this as an accountability step if for no other reason.

Just like you'd weigh yourself periodically or measure the changes in your physical endurance, you'll want to keep a running journal of how you're progressing with your plan. Plans laid out for you will be easier to assess because someone else has already set bench marks for progress.

The practice of keeping yourself accountable consistently pulls your goals closer and closer. Making modifications becomes an art form rather than a nuisance because you've been able to measure your results.

The Last Mile

Breaking down your long range goals will keep you from exhaustion or burn out just like consistently tracking your journey will encourage you to keep going.

Your dream doesn't lose its luster or allure because it's been mapped out and planned with mathematical precision. Instead it comes to life almost out of the gate and you realize the value in the entire process not just the end result.
